Story

Alison Williamson was a young wife and mother who died in May 2016 after being diagnosed with Hepatosplenic T-cell Lymphoma - a very rare and aggressive type of blood cancer.

Her husband Barry felt the best way to honour Alison's memory was to raise money for Leukaemia & Lymphoma NI to be used to research the causes and cures for blood cancers. 

In 2016 Barry, along with family and friends, raised an awe-inspiring £52,000 in Alison's memory.

This campaign is to allow people to continue Barry's amazing work and to carry out fundraising events in memory of Alison.

All money raised will go directly to Leukaemia & Lymphoma NI, the only charity in Northern Ireland dedicated to blood cancer research.
